Redwood Materials is a US-based company focused on creating a circular and sustainable supply chain for lithium-ion batteries. Founded by JB Straubel, co-founder and former CTO of Tesla, Redwood develops and deploys new technologies to recycle, refine, and remanufacture battery materials, such as copper, cobalt, nickel, and lithium, from end-of-life batteries and manufacturing scrap. Their mission is to reduce the environmental footprint of batteries, decrease reliance on mining, and build a domestic source of critical materials for electric vehicles and clean energy storage, thereby accelerating the transition to sustainable energy.

Redwood Materials currently operates primarily within the United States, with a strategic focus on building a robust domestic closed-loop supply chain for battery materials. While its physical manufacturing footprint is US-based, its mission and impact are global. Redwood partners with international companies for battery recycling feedstock and aims to provide sustainable material solutions that reduce the worldwide reliance on virgin mined materials and decrease the carbon footprint of battery production globally.

The Nevada Independent • May 30, 2024
Redwood Materials secured an additional $480 million conditional loan commitment from the U.S. Department of Energy to expand its battery materials campus in Storey County, Nevada. This funding supports the company's efforts to scale domestic production of critical battery components....more
Electrek • February 14, 2024
Redwood Materials announced the start of commercial-scale production of anode copper foil made from recycled materials at its Nevada facility, a key component for EV batteries. This marks a significant step in localizing the battery supply chain....more
Reuters • November 14, 2023
Redwood Materials and Panasonic Energy announced a partnership where Redwood will supply Panasonic with cathode active materials and anode copper foil produced from recycled battery content for use in Panasonic's new battery cell manufacturing facility in Kansas....more
